WebWhat is Little-c Culture. 1. This consists of the routine aspects of life, such as the things people know, believe, and do within a culture, and includes styles of communication, conceptions of time, and notions of beauty, goodness, and rightness. Webtopic regarding small ‘c’ culture included values, beliefs and attitudes, followed by everyday living and interpersonal relations. Key words: cultural content, big ‘C’ culture, small ‘c’ culture, EFL materials, university level 1. Introduction Culture can be divided into two distinct groups: big ‘C’ and small ‘c’ culture.
